Social media in clinical dietetics
How LinkedIn and Twitter can support you in clinical practice
Friday October 28 , 2016, 1.30pm to 2.30pm AEDT
The presentation will cover:
When and how to use LinkedIn and Twitter professionally
How can LinkedIn and Twitter help you in your clinical practice?
Ethical issues in using social media professionally eg. Privacy/disclosure
Case studies

About the Presenter
Teri Lichtenstein is an APD with more than 10 years’ experience in digital and social media marketing. With a diploma in business management and a nutrition marketing career in the FMCG and healthcare industries, in 2014 Teri established FoodBytes, a nutrition consulting agency with a focus on digital and social media communications. FoodBytes helps dietitians, organisations and companies use social media to increase customer engagement and brand advocacy. Her clients include Deakin University, Simplot, ntegrity digital agency and others.
